"If you: wish to apply for a Canada Pension Plan Surviving Child's benefit or Disabled Contributor's Child's benefit; and are age 18 or older, but under age 25, and in full-time attendance at school or university, you must complete an "Application for Canada Pension Plan Child's Benefits under the Convention on Social Security between Canada and the Republic of Peru". This guide has been prepared to help you fill out the application form. Please read the guide carefully and follow the instructions which are given. In order to act on your application as quickly as possible Service Canada must have all the information which is requested in the application form. The more accurately the form is completed, the better we can serve you."
